Name Patchwork Beastie Edit card
Type Artifact creature — beast
Description Delirium — Patchwork Beastie can't attack or block unless there are four or more card types among cards in your graveyard. At the beginning of your upkeep, you may mill a card. (You may put the top card of your library into your graveyard.)
Flavor It doesn't know it isn't real.
Artist John Tedrick
Set Duskmourn: House of Horror #195

About Patchwork Beastie

Patchwork Beastie, Artifact creature — beast, designed by John Tedrick first released in Sep, 2024 in the set Duskmourn: House of Horror. It see play in 1 formats: Commander.

Patchwork Beastie would fit well in a graveyard-focused deck, particularly those that utilize a variety of card types to trigger delirium, such as Dredge or Self-Mill strategies. Decks that include cards like Tarmogoyf or The Gitrog Monster can benefit from the ability to fill the graveyard with different card types while also leveraging the Beastie's milling ability for further synergy. While there are stronger options for aggressive or resilient creatures, such as Scavenging Ooze or Lurrus of the Dream-Den, Patchwork Beastie's unique ability to mill and its conditional power can still make it a fun and interesting choice in the right deck, especially in formats where graveyard interactions are prevalent.
